No official "Sega CD" version of Captain Tsubasa exists in Spanish; the original game was released exclusively in Japan on September 30, 1994. However, there are fan-translated versions and resources available in Spanish for this title. Overview: Captain Tsubasa for Sega CD
The original game was only released in Japan. However, the dedicated retro gaming community has produced "español" patches and pre-patched ROMs. These fan translations ensure that every dialogue box, menu, and special move name is accessible to Spanish speakers, keeping the spirit of the "Supercampeones" alive.
